samnewbie Posted May 6, 2010 Author #3 Share Posted May 6, 2010 More info as posted on fb with the photos - Here is a preview of two @NCLFreestyle Epic dining venues, Le Bistro and Taste. Taste, located in the ship’s atrium on Deck 5, midship, blends off-white, free-form plastered walls with European retro-chic mixed with brick details and floor-to-ceiling velvet curtains. Taste will serve a selection of traditional and contemporary cuisine for breakfast, lunch and dinner. Le Bistro is Norwegian's signature French restaurant with an American flair.
